The role you’ll contribute:
The Radiation Therapist – Advanced is a registered and licensed professional who is responsible for administering therapeutic radiation in accordance with the physician’s prescription to age specific groups identified in the direct care responsibilities.
Actively participates in outstanding customer service and accepts responsibility in maintaining relationships that are equally respectful to all.
The value you’ll bring to the team:
- Assesses the patients’ needs and actively seeks to resolve any potential problems or conflicts.
Seeks advice from chief therapist/supervisor as necessary. Treats the patient in a timely and courteous manner. Handles stressful situations appropriately and demonstrates the ability to communicate with patients of all ages. Clinically observes patient reactions to treatment and assists in accommodating the patient through the treatment process.
- Verifies the physician’s prescription and treatment parameters daily to ensure accurate treatment of the patient in accordance with the prescription and treatment plan. Identifies the treatment volume and positions the patient in a consistent and reproducible manner.
- Performs all aspects of CT Simulation. Under the direction of the physician or non-physician practitioner, administers contrast agents during simulation localization. Immediately reports and documents adverse reactions to the managing physician and Site Leader.
- Evaluates prescribed imaging and makes requested changes within 24 hours. Accurately documents treatment information in the patient electronic health record (EHR). Utilizes the record and verify system.
- Reviews all new starts for consistency prior to treatment.
Checks the blocks, simulation documents, dose calculation sheet, prescription, field photos to verify patient positioning and field orientation. Checks record and verify system for prescription, treatment parameters, doses, treatment accessories and monitor units. Documents in the EHR that the medical plan was reviewed for consistency.
Qualifications
The expertise and experiences you’ll need to succeed :
- Minimum three years’ experience as a Radiation Therapist
- Registered with the American Registry of Radiologic Technologists (ARRT)
- Licensed by the State of Florida as a Certified Radiologic Technologist (CRT)
- Basic Life Support (BLS) Certified
